Stocks rallied modestly on Thursday, with financials and energies leading the way higher.

Here are 7 ETFs You Need to Know for Friday.


After a three-day pullback, the Financial Select Sector SPDR ETF ( XLF | Quote | Chart | News | PowerRating) was one among a number of financial-related exchange-traded funds to move higher on Thursday. Gaining more than 5% intra-day was the ProShares Ultra Financial ETF ( UYG | Quote | Chart | News | PowerRating), back in overbought territory below the 200-day moving average.


Rallying after a two-day pullback above its 200-day moving average was the iShares Dow Jones Energy Services Index ETF ( IYE | Quote | Chart | News | PowerRating), which benefited from strong energy prices on Thursday.


Sellers emerged in health care-related ETFs on Thursday, taking advantage of recent gains by taking profits in ETFs like the Health Care Select SPDR ETF ( XLV | Quote | Chart | News | PowerRating) and the iShares Dow Jones Healthcare Services ETF ( IYH | Quote | Chart | News | PowerRating), both off more than 1% intra-day.


After dipping into oversold territory above its 200-day moving average on Wednesday, shares of the Market Vectors Coal ETF ( KOL | Quote | Chart | News | PowerRating) were up by more than 4% intraday late on Thursday.


While a number of country ETFs - especially in Asian - were rallying from recent oversold conditions above the 200-day, a few funds, such as the iShares MSCI Taiwan Index ETF ( EWT | Quote | Chart | News | PowerRating) remained largely oversold during Thursday's trading.
